Re: Green Luna Camper Project!
Thats looking good, your doing really well
The only thing i would say is you could possibly do with upping the power of your welder a notch. The weld looks a little high. Dont think im being an a*** about it though just trying to help.
[quote=
My welding is getting better. Current settings are 0.6 wire : 9l per min argon/Co2 mix : 1m of wire in 20 secs : power setting 2 (what ever that is)
[/quote]
